Birthdays are a special occasion that only come about yearly in a person’s life, and a good way to make someone feel special and appreciated on these once in a year occasions is to give a present of some kind. Many companies have adapted these tactics of giving ‘gifts’ and have created systems to make their loyal customers happy and keep coming back by giving out freebies in place of birthday presents. While there are many more businesses that offer birthday ‘gifts’, the majority of those and the ones from this list are behind a membership wall that requires the consumer to sign up to receive them. Despite that, it is still a flattering ‘gift’ someone may receive on their birthday no matter if it is something that needs a membership to receive.
